Deadly gunfire at airport; Taliban insist on US pullout date
August 22, 2021
KABUL, Afghanistan (AP) — A firefight outside Kabul's international airport killed an Afghan soldier early Monday, highlighting the perils of evacuation efforts even as the Taliban warned any attempt by U.S. troops to delay their withdrawal to give people more time to flee would "provoke a reaction."
The shooting came as the Taliban moved to shore up their position and eliminate pockets of armed resistance to their lightning takeover earlier this month.
